5 Points. Apple Desired Information Privacy Law.

 

  • tech companies should de-identify customer data or not collect customer data
  • comprehensive federal law is necessary
    • why? tech companies that collect a lot of data are basically spies
  • people should have a right in their data, and a right to have that data minimized
  • consumers must be told what data is being collected & why
  • the data belongs to the users and users (consumers) should always have access to it

The gold standard law: GDPR in the EU
